Chinese delegation to visit

Mr Zeng Jianhui, a member of the Standing Committee of the National People's Congress of China and chairman of the Foreign Affairs Committee, will be leading a delegation on an official visit to Malta between tomorrow and Tuesday.

The delegation will include Mr Yu Enguang, a Deputy of the NPC and a member of the Foreign Affairs Committee.

The Department of Information said the main objective of the visit is to provide another opportunity to further consolidate relations between the two countries as well as to explore new areas of cooperation in the light of bilateral relations and international cooperation.

The delegation will be meeting the Foreign Affairs Committee of the House of Representatives and will pay courtesy calls on the President, the Speaker, the economic services and foreign affairs ministers and the leader of the opposition.
